L-shaped layout

An L-shaped kitchen floor plan can be used to optimize space in small and medium kitchens. It's a versatile design, and you can easily change it to suit your specific needs. This layout features work centers along two walls, which is a departure from traditional kitchen designs. It allows plenty of space for an island, or dining area. It is similar to a U-shape kitchen but offers more space.

An L-shaped kitchen floor plan is generally comprised of two adjacent walls and two long runs of cabinetry. The length of each leg can be varied, depending on the size of the room and the available storage space. This layout works well for small kitchens, but it can also be used with larger ones. You can also add an island for more countertop space, but keep in mind that it requires additional floor space and walkways.

A U-shaped kitchen layout has two main sides. It is great for increasing counter space. It is possible to fit appliances and cabinets on one side, and a refrigerator and freezer on the opposite. The largest U-shaped kitchens can even have room for an island to provide additional work space. A U-shaped design allows you to have a large or small kitchen. It is also great for entertaining. This layout allows for ample cooking space for large groups without creating traffic patterns.

Peninsula layout

You may consider installing continuous countertops on a peninsula to give your kitchen a seamless look. These countertops are less difficult to clean and offer more flexibility in the addition of utilities. In addition, they don't require the use of space under the floor. For small kitchens, you might want to add stools and a bar on the peninsula to increase your seating.

You will need to measure your peninsula before you start planning your kitchen floor plan. You should ensure that the space is large enough to allow you to move around it without bumping into your hips. Measure 90cm from the nearest wall to determine the size of your peninsula. This will tell you how much space you have for your peninsula. Also, ensure that there is enough space for outdoor stools.

A peninsula kitchen floorplan gives the cook plenty of storage space and workspace. It gives the chef ample prep, cooking, and clean-up space. For larger kitchens, this design allows for a smaller countertop area.
